Avondale School District is located 21 miles north of Detroit, educates over 3,700 students in grades K-12. Nearly 36,000 residents live within the district boundaries which encompasses portions of four of the more progressive, dynamic and growing municipalities in Oakland County, Michigan, e.g., Auburn Hills, Bloomfield Township, Rochester Hills and Troy. These communities are home to several int

ernational corporations and offer easy access to many of the Detroit metropolitan areas greatest resources for academic, cultural, athletic and recreational services.

The graduation celebrations continued on Friday, May 29, as Avondale's Adult Transition Program (ATP; previously SKILL) proudly honored four graduates during a special ceremony at the newly renovated Adult Learning Center! πŸŽ“πŸ’œπŸ’›

This year's graduates hold a special distinction as the first students to complete the program and graduate from the transformed facility, made possible through the support of the 2024 Bond Program.

We are incredibly proud of these graduates and all they have accomplished. Congratulations to the ATP Class of 2026! We look forward to seeing the many ways you will continue to learn, grow, and make a positive impact in your communities. 🌟

The Adult Transition Program serves Avondale residents ages 18-26 with developmental or cognitive disabilities, providing opportunities to build vocational, social, and independent living skills while learning to navigate community resources and real-world experiences. πŸ’‘πŸŒŽπŸš€ Innovation Day Showcases Student Creativity & Problem-Solving

Students across Avondale Schools recently put their creativity, critical thinking, and collaboration skills on display during Innovation Day events held throughout the district!

Working alongside their classroom teachers with the support of gifted education and instructional technology coach Michelle Gierman, students at the elementary level, middle school, and GATE Magnet School engaged in the design thinking process to identify real-world problems and develop innovative solutions. Throughout the semester, students researched issues, brainstormed ideas, created prototypes, gathered feedback, and refined their thinking before presenting their final projects.

The challenges students chose to tackle reflected both local and global concerns. Some groups explored ways to protect beetle populations and support butterfly life cycles, while others focused on addressing the global water crisis, improving environmental sustainability, or developing equitable and responsible uses of artificial intelligence. Each project highlighted students' ability to think creatively while applying learning to meaningful real-world situations.
